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
[SOLVED] Borderlands TLP on Steam
View unanswered posts
View posts from last 24 hours

 
Reply to topic    Gentoo Forums Forum Index Gamers & Players
View previous topic :: View next topic  
Author Message
tenspd1370
Tux's lil' helper
Tux's lil' helper


Joined: 14 Dec 2017
Posts: 119

PostPosted: Fri Jun 22, 2018 5:07 am    Post subject: [SOLVED] Borderlands TLP on Steam Reply with quote

Hi all -

I have a problem. To get Borderlands TLP to run I have disabled cut scenes as outlined here:

https://wiki.gentoo.org/wiki/Steam/Games_troubleshooting#Unity-based_games

Additionally the game may still crash at points during game play, when creating a new character or when traveling to one of the DLC's. To workaround this issue edit the willowengine.ini file. Find the section [FullScreenMovie] and change the value of bForceNoMovies from FALSE to TRUE. The files can be found at ~/.local/share/aspyr-media/borderlands 2/willowgame/config/willowengine.ini and ~/.local/share/aspyr-media/borderlands the pre-sequel/willowgame/config/willowengine.ini.

The problem is in the beginning of the game when your character is in the container and "moonshot", you need to enable the cut scenes to get out of the container.

Is there a way around this?

I have read here: https://forums.gentoo.org/viewtopic-t-1074698.html

That rebuilding things like glibc with -mstackrealign helped some people with something, but I don't know how to add -mstackrealign

or here: https://bugs.archlinux.org/task/49560

building libxcb with -01 helps (dmesg shows:
BorderlandsPreS[1385] general protection ip:f7251299 sp:ff885724 error:0 in libxcb.so.1.1.0[f7246000+2a000])
This could be done by altering the environment per: https://wiki.gentoo.org/wiki/Knowledge_Base:Overriding_environment_variables_per_package

Any suggestions?

*********************************
Solved - I found that by compiling libxcb and pulseaudio with -O1 in the CFLAGS altering envrionment variables on a per package basis worked. I have cut scenes now!
*********************************
Back to top
View user's profile Send private message
djdunn
l33t
l33t


Joined: 26 Dec 2004
Posts: 810

PostPosted: Sat Jun 23, 2018 12:06 am    Post subject: Reply with quote

well i have borderlands 2

the bugs are pretty much the same since they are similar, same bugs you had there.

i do run ~amd64, radeonsi drivers

but ~amd64 with gcc-7.3 had some bugs that got fixed in gcc-8, including the bug with the mstackrealign workaround.

so when i rebuild everything with gcc-8 the bugs got ironed out and borderlands 2 started working fine, videos and all. its likely a bug with one of the flags with -O2, i heard some rumors about some of the cflags in some -march='s was causing problems too
_________________
“Music is a moral law. It gives a soul to the Universe, wings to the mind, flight to the imagination, a charm to sadness, gaiety and life to everything. It is the essence of order, and leads to all that is good and just and beautiful.”

― Plato
Back to top
View user's profile Send private message
est921
n00b
n00b


Joined: 20 Dec 2015
Posts: 28

PostPosted: Tue Nov 27, 2018 6:58 pm    Post subject: Reply with quote

I know I'm half a year late but do any of you remember how you solved this? I have rebuilt glibc (and most other things) with gcc 8 but still experince the type of bugs you describe
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Gamers & Players All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um